What 2 people ran against each other for the 3rd president of the united states?

Jefferson~VS~Burr

who was the 3rd president of the united states?(section 1)

True or False:


The election of 1800 was a very friendly campaign.

FALSE!! the election of 1800 was bitter

(section 1)

What was there talk of in the election of 1800?

Civil war and Monarchy.

2 bad things(section 1)

True or False:


The electoral college tied in the election of 1800.

TRUE!! (73-73)

section 1

Where did the vote go after the electoral college tied?

The house of representatives.

section 1

Who was James Bayard?

The man who decided the president.(the only one who changed his vote)

Section 1

How long did it take for one of the members to change their vote?

4 Days;36 Voting Processes

Section 1

What is the 12th Amendment?

The elections for President and Vice President were SEPARATE.

Section 1

Explain the duel between Hamilton and Burr. What were the results?

Burr (the vice president)~VS~Hamilton (secretary of state) it was an illegal duel.Burr kills Hamilton.

Section 1

Who was the 3rd president?

Thomas Jefferson

Section 1(who won the election)

In 1801 what portion of america were farmers?

9/10

Section 1

What did Jefferson try to expand?

The rights of ordinary citizens.

Section 1

Name Jefferson's quote regarding republicans and federalists.

"We are all republicans;we are all federalists"-Thomas Jefferson

Section 1

How many terms did the 3rd president serve?

2 Terms (follows G.W.'s precedent)

Thomas Jefferson(section 1)

True or False:


Thomas Jefferson was very casual.

TRUE!!

Section 1

Who's fears did Jefferson wish to ease?

The federalists

Section 1

Who wanted to lower national debt?

Jefferson

section 1

What does Laissez Faire mean?

let alone

Section 1

What is the HUGE case talked about in this chapter?

Marbury~VS~Madison

Section 1

What is the judicial review?

power of supreme court to review a law

Section 1
